About the Role: 

AA Environmental Limited’s environmental permitting team are looking to recruit a Graduate Environmental Consultant to support the delivery of field work, compliance advice and the development of permits. The team works on complex permits associated with the circular economy and are technical experts and leaders in their specialism.

You will work directly with the Senior Management Team to deliver projects both in field work and report work. The work includes soil and water sampling, Construction Quality Assurance inspections, compliance assessments and support in the development of environmental permit submissions. The role is physical requiring good health and also will necessitate intermittent travelling and nights away.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Conduct site inspections and compliance assessments.
  • Perform soil and water testing, including groundwater monitoring and surface water sampling.
  • Write detailed reports to support permitting documents.
  • Communicate effectively with stakeholders and engineers.
  • Assist in updating Environmental Management System documents.
